In response to Trump's 50% tariffs on Indian goods, anti-American sentiment is rising in India, prompting calls to boycott major U.S. brands like McDonald's and Coca-Cola. While American companies have a foothold in the rapidly growing Indian market, there are growing appeals from business leaders and Modi's supporters to prioritize local products over foreign imports. Despite ongoing protests, the impact on sales remains unclear, with some consumers continuing to patronize American brands.
